NEW ORLEANS - The NOPD as arrested a 17-year-old male juvenile accused in a Sixth District armed robbery and several other incidents that occurred in the First, Second, and Sixth Districts.
On Tuesday, March 2, 2021, Sixth District Person’s Crime detectives, NOPD Violent Offender Warrant Squad and the U.S. Marshals Service located and arrested the wanted subject in relation to an armed robbery that occurred on January 18, 2021 in the 1100 block of Jackson Avenue in the Sixth District.
A search warrant was obtained for the residence. During the execution of that warrant, the following items were recovered:
A stolen black Glock 19 with a tan grip
An Aero Precision x15 rifle, along with several armor piercing 5.56 rounds
Black gloves, ski masks, and a small plastic bag containing 97 Ecstasy pills (MDMA).
The arrested juvenile subject was booked and charged with:
Illegal possession of Schedule I Narcotic with intent to Distribute
Illegal Possession of a Firearm while in possession of Scheduled Narcotic
Two counts of Illegal possession of a firearm by a juvenile.
The arrested juvenile subject was also wanted in connection with the following incidents:
2 counts relative to simple burglary and 2 counts relative to simple criminal damage to property in the First District
5 counts relative to simple burglary, 2 counts relative to attempted simple burglary of vehicle and 3 counts relative to simple criminal damage to property in the First District
3 counts relative to simple burglary and 3 counts relative to simple criminal damage to property in the First District
1 count relative to simple burglary in the Sixth District
2 counts relative to simple burglary in the Sixth District
1 count relative to simple burglary in the Sixth District
12 counts relative to simple burglary and 12 counts relative to simple criminal damage to property in the Second District
3 counts Relative to simple burglary in the Sixth District
1 count relative to illegal possession of stolen things in the Sixth District
2 counts relative to simple burglary in the Sixth District
